Cavity-QED assisted “attraction” between an exciton and a cavity mode in a planar photonic-crystal cavity

Abstract

We introduce a new regime of light-matter interaction, whereby a single exciton and photonic-crystal cavity mode are mutually “attracted” as they are tuned through resonance. This phenomenon is successfully explained by a quantized medium-dependent theory.
